Armstrong is an unincorporated community in St. Johns County, Florida, United States, located off State Road 207. It was established in 1886 and became an African American community along a rail line. Potatoes and turpentine were among the products produced commercially in the area.[1]

Armstrong is the location of the Saint Johns County Fairgrounds, though the fairgrounds lists their address as being in nearby Elkton.
